Key Appointments in the Gaming Industry: January 2026

The gaming industry has seen a multitude of appointments and transitions in recent times. To keep track of these developments, we have compiled a list of key personnel changes. Virtuos has named Karl Stricker as its Chief Revenue Officer, who will report directly to CEO Gilles Langourieux. Stricker brings over two decades of experience in the gaming and technology sectors, having held leadership roles at Microsoft and Amazon. Valentine Piedelievre-Eman has been appointed as Chief Communications Officer at Ubisoft, where she will lead the development and implementation of the company's global communications and corporate brand strategy. Dan Prigg has joined Paramount as Executive Vice President and Head of Games, responsible for executing the company's long-term interactive entertainment strategy. UKIE has appointed Cinzia Musio as its Programme Manager, who will lead the organization's equity, diversity, and inclusion strategy. Joshua Lamb has joined Ubisoft's UK communications team as Communications Manager, bringing his experience in journalism to the role. Other notable appointments include Jo Cooke as CEO at Frontier Developments, Jori Pearsall as Senior Vice President of Games at Niantic, and Katie Scott as Head of Minecraft Vanilla at Mojang Studios.
